
THE VALUES AND RIGHTS OF TURKISH CYPRIOTS MUST BE RESPECTED ![]() THE VALUES AND RIGHTS OF TURKISH CYPRIOTS MUST BE RESPECTED Former President Ersin Tatar stated, “Just as we do not want the church bells to be silenced, the Greek Cypriot side must show the same respect for the flag and sacred values of the Turkish Cypriot nation.” In a written statement, Tatar noted that the attacks by the Greek Cypriot administration against the values, sacred values, and rights of the Turkish Cypriot people have increased in recent days. Tatar stated that the proposal to remove the TRNC flag from the Five Finger Mountains under the guise of a “confidence-building measure,” as reported in a South Cypriot newspaper, is absolutely unacceptable. Tatar added, “The decision to change the name of Kemal Atatürk Street in Paphos during the same period is another indication of the intolerance on the Greek Cypriot side. The Greek Cypriot administration is clearly becoming increasingly arrogant with the support it receives from the UN and the EU, pushing its intransigence to its peak.” Tatar continued his statement as follows: “Let no one miscalculate. The Turkish Cypriot people will continue to resolutely protect their state, flag, and national values. We have never targeted the religious values of the Greek Cypriot community. We have respected their churches, bells, and places of worship. Today, in the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us, places of worship belonging to different faiths are protected, necessary restorations are carried out, and religious freedoms are respected. Just as we do not want the church bells to be silenced, the Greek Cypriot side must show the same respect for the flag and sacred values of the Turkish nation.” Stating that peace is possible through mutual understanding and respect, Tatar noted that the steps taken by some circles on the Greek Cypriot side who still harbor the dream of Enosis are harming the atmosphere of reconciliation. Tatar stated, “The Turkish Cypriot people are determined to protect their rights, sovereignty, and sacred values. No one should have any doubt about this.
